            Just to share. When my dd was in P5, I decided not to opt for HCL as I felt that she was spending too much time on Chinese compared to the other subjects. After PSLE, when we were applying for IP schools, we realised that most of these schools has HCL as a compulsory subject… there was no normal Chinese. My dd has a hard time studying secondary level HCL. The jump from normal Chinese to HCL was huge. I reckon if she has taken HCL in P5 & 6, perhaps the transition may not have been so difficult.

                      nmhmum:
                      Just to share, my dd's Chinese teacher told me that if the child fails her HCL in her PSLE, she will not have a chance to take HCL in her secondary school, but if a child did not take higher chinese but get good grades for her PSLE, she still will get a chance to offer higher Chinese in secondary school. Is this true?

                      My boy did not take HCL in P5 & P6. He was in the top 10% of his PSLE cohort & he only gets A for CL. However, he is currently taking HCL in Sec 1.

                      If your child is within 11-30%, then she has to get at least merit for her HCL or A* for CL. She can continue to take HCL in Sec, if she is in the top 10%, regardless of her HCL result.
